HackerRank

HackerRank is a platform that allows companies to conduct interviews remotely to hire developers and for technical assessment purposes.

Hybrid-Analysis.com

Hybrid-Analysis.com is a free malware analysis service powered by payload-security.com.

  • Comprehensive Malware Analysis
    Hybrid-Analysis.com provides in-depth malware analysis which leverages machine learning and behavioral analysis to detect and diagnose potential threats accurately.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The platform features an intuitive interface which makes it easy for users, including those with limited technical knowledge, to navigate and conduct analyses.
  • Detailed Reports
    Users receive detailed reports which include relevant information about the malware’s behavior, origin, and potential impact, aiding in thorough investigations.
  • Community Sharing
    The service allows for the sharing of analysis results with the community, enabling collaboration and the exchange of vital threat information among professionals.
  • API Access
    Hybrid-Analysis.com provides API access which allows for the integration of its capabilities into other tools and workflows, enhancing overall efficiency.
  • Freemium Model
    The platform offers a freemium model, allowing users to access a range of basic features for free, with advanced features accessible via subscription.

Possible disadvantages

  • Limited Free Tier Capabilities
    While the free tier is beneficial, it has limitations in terms of feature access and the volume of analyses that can be conducted, which may be restrictive for some users.
  • Data Privacy Concerns
    Uploading files for analysis can raise data privacy concerns, particularly for sensitive or proprietary information, making it less suitable for certain organizations or individuals.
  • Performance Issues
    Some users may experience performance issues such as slow analysis times or intermittent downtimes, which can impede productivity during urgent threat assessments.
  • Learning Curve for Advanced Features
    Although the basic interface is user-friendly, mastering advanced features and maximizing the platform’s capabilities might require a steep learning curve.
  • Subscription Costs
    Accessing the full suite of features and higher tiers of service requires a subscription, which may be costly for smaller organizations or individual users.
  • Potential False Positives
    Like all malware analysis tools, Hybrid-Analysis.com can sometimes yield false positives, requiring additional verification to ensure accurate threat detection.
